Core Viewpoint - The "萤光" juvenile prosecution team in Zhengzhou's Erqi District aims to enhance juvenile justice protection by integrating the spirit of role models into daily work and extending protective measures beyond case handling [1] Group 1: Team Initiatives - The "萤光" team has established a comprehensive protection framework consisting of a case handling team, four protection bases, and a 4+1+N protection model to effectively manage juvenile cases while preventing crime and providing education and support [1] - The team emphasizes the motto "the more we do, the less harm children will suffer," reflecting their commitment to reducing juvenile victimization [2] Group 2: Collaborative Efforts - The team has partnered with Zhengzhou University Third Affiliated Hospital to create a "萤光·心理修复基地" for psychological intervention, employing a professional team to address emotional issues among juveniles involved in legal cases [3] - A one-stop inquiry and rescue mechanism for juvenile victims was established in 2018, enhancing collaboration with various departments to provide comprehensive support [2] Group 3: Rehabilitation and Education - The team has implemented conditional non-prosecution for juvenile offenders, focusing on rehabilitation and skill development, as seen in the case of a 17-year-old who obtained a massage qualification certificate [4] - A "萤光·行为矫治基地" was created to link prosecution duties with specialized educational institutions for juvenile rehabilitation [4] Group 4: Prevention and Governance - The team actively participates in social governance, addressing issues related to underage access to hotels and internet cafes, resulting in warnings and penalties for over 26 non-compliant establishments [5] - Utilizing big data for legal supervision, the team has developed a multi-faceted rescue mechanism for at-risk juveniles, collaborating with various organizations to provide judicial, psychological, and educational support [6]
